Output e395a61f63f393fb9460e7a82791ca38c35ad11cbfcdbd8664ef316788180078:13

value
7434580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4224fe20b5bb4a6ff76c4c76110ac23f77e49c5c OP_EQUALVERIFY OP_CHECKSIG
address
172juxYpP5FkBhLS8VLSqUk2BSNkjQJ3fR
transaction
e395a61f63f393fb9460e7a82791ca38c35ad11cbfcdbd8664ef316788180078
confirmations
431551
spent
true